                            Originally posted by Danonino
                            Greetings,

                            I’ve been flying the FW F-14 for a few months and have a question about flight modes:

                            I use 3 modes - takeoff (high rates, 10° flaps), cruise (medium rates, gear up, flaps up) and wings swept (low rates, flaps disabled).

                            Each flight mode, specifically with wings swept, require different trims. Will my NX10 store the trim settings for each flight mode?
                            Yes. Go into Trim Setup (from the setup menu screen) and set the trim type to "F Mode" instead of "Common".

                              Originally posted by vicentel

                              Hi Guys - Thanks for the quick replies. What I mean is I want to be able to proportionally control the swing of the wings. Rather than having the "landing gear" type mechanism (2 position) that they are currently where they are either fully swept or fully forward. But I would be happy with a 3 position wing with a mid-sweep setting.

                              My thinking is along the lines of removing the current swing wing servos and replace them with 2x high torque servos (I found 35kg stall torque @ 6V). Use long aluminum servo arms that clamp on to the spline (~1.25"-1.5"). I would have to design a way to mount the servos, probably 1/16" (~1.5mm) thick aluminum plate.

                              Cheers,
                              Vic
                              So I decided to start this little project. I was able to find an L-shaped aluminum bar stock, a couple of High Torque Savox standard size servos (which includes the metal servo arm). I was able to construct a bracket and base the mounting holes on the standard out-of-the-box bracket. I was able to get everything to fit and programed the mid-sweep and tied it to my flight mode switch. The servos pictured here are not the final ones I used, these though we strong had no holding power. I did manage to maiden my F-14 with this mod and was successful. I'll try to get some video of the flight when I get back from my business trip.





                              Cheers,
                              Vic
